Automated Trading Strategies for CIS
Quantitative trading, often referred to as quant trading, employs mathematical and statistical models to make trading decisions. It can be a powerful strategy while trading CIS, allowing for automation and efficiency. By utilizing quantitative trading techniques, traders can analyze vast amounts of historical data to identify patterns and trends. These strategies can be programmed into algorithms to automatically execute trades based on pre-determined rules and criteria. The advantage of quantitative trading lies in its ability to remove human emotions and biases from the decision-making process, leading to more objective and disciplined trading. It offers the potential to capitalize on market inefficiencies and quickly react to changing market conditions. Moreover, quantitative trading provides the opportunity to diversify and manage risk by spreading trades across different assets and markets. Incorporating quantitative trading into your CIS trading approach can enhance your trading performance and assist in navigating the markets in an automated and systematic way.

Price Drivers: CIS Market Influences
Factors Influencing CIS Price
The price of CIS, or Cisco Systems, Inc., can be influenced by various factors that traders should consider. First and foremost is the general market sentiment and economic conditions. Positive news about the economy can drive up investor confidence and lead to increased demand for CIS stocks, pushing the price higher. Conversely, negative economic news may have the opposite effect.
Additionally, industry trends and competition play a significant role. If CIS introduces a groundbreaking product or service, it can generate excitement and boost the stock price. On the other hand, increased competition from other tech companies may put downward pressure on CIS price.
Investor sentiment and market expectations are crucial as well. Earnings reports and financial performance of CIS, such as revenue growth and profitability, can greatly influence the stock price. Positive results can lead to increased investor optimism and higher share prices.
Moreover, geopolitical events and regulatory changes can impact CIS price. International trade agreements, government policies, and geopolitical tensions can create volatility in the market and affect the overall sentiment towards CIS.
To make informed trading decisions, it is essential for traders to stay updated on these factors and assess their potential impact on the CIS stock price. Conducting thorough research, monitoring news and market indicators, and practicing risk management can help traders navigate the dynamic nature of CIS trading successfully.
Profitable CIS Swings: Trading Strategies
Swing Trading Strategies for CIS
Swing trading can be an effective approach for trading CIS, offering traders the opportunity to capture short to medium-term price movements. One popular strategy is trend following, where traders identify the overall trend of CIS stocks and enter positions in the direction of that trend. By using technical indicators like moving averages and chart patterns, traders can spot potential entry and exit points for profitable trades.
Another strategy is breakouts, where traders look for significant price movements above resistance or below support levels. When a breakout occurs, it indicates a potential shift in market sentiment, and traders can capitalize on the momentum.
Furthermore, traders can utilize swing trading strategies that incorporate a combination of technical indicators and fundamental analysis. They can identify catalysts such as earnings reports, product launches, or industry news that may cause significant price movements in CIS stocks.
Risk management is crucial in swing trading. Setting stop-loss orders to protect against potential losses and ensuring proper position sizing can help manage risk effectively.
Overall, swing trading strategies for CIS provide traders with opportunities to profit from short to medium-term price fluctuations. By combining technical analysis, fundamental analysis, and risk management, traders can enhance their chances of success in swing trading CIS.

Trading strategy parameters are specific variables or values that are essential for defining and implementing a trading strategy. These parameters act as guidelines or rules for making trading decisions. They can include indicators, timeframes, entry and exit points, stop-loss levels, and profit targets. By adjusting these parameters, traders can refine their strategies and adapt to different market conditions. It is important to carefully consider and test these parameters before implementing them to ensure they align with the trader's goals and risk tolerance. Regular monitoring and evaluation of the strategy parameters can help improve trading performance over time.
